Building Stronger Communities: The Need for Community Storm Shelters in Texas

In the vast expanse of Texas, where diverse landscapes and climates converge, residents are no strangers to extreme weather events. From scorching heatwaves to the unpredictability of severe storms, Texans face a range of challenges.

Among these, the looming threat of tornadoes stands out, prompting a critical discussion about community preparedness and the indispensable role of community storm shelters.

The Texas Tornado Challenge

The state’s expansive geography and varying weather patterns create a perfect storm for these destructive phenomena. Communities across Texas must confront the reality that tornadoes can strike at any time, necessitating a collective and comprehensive approach to storm preparedness.

The Limitations of Individual Preparedness

While individual families may have storm shelters on their properties, the limitations become apparent in densely populated areas. In urban and suburban settings, the space required for individual shelters may not be readily available. Additionally, the costs associated with installing private shelters for every household can be prohibitive.

The Role of Community Storm Shelters

The need for community storm shelters becomes evident as a more practical and cost-effective solution. These shared spaces, strategically located within neighborhoods, serve as a haven for residents during severe weather events. The benefits extend beyond mere convenience, playing a pivotal role in fostering resilience, unity, and overall community strength.

Advantages of Community Storm Shelters

Accessibility for All

Community storm shelters are designed with inclusivity in mind, ensuring that everyone, including those with mobility challenges, has equal access to a safe refuge during storms.

Capacity and Efficiency

By consolidating resources into centralized locations, community storm shelters can accommodate larger numbers of people more efficiently than individual shelters. This is crucial in densely populated areas where space is limited.

Strategic Placement

Placing storm shelters strategically within communities ensures that residents are within a short distance of safety during emergencies. This reduces response time and enhances overall preparedness.

Cost-Effective Solutions

Investing in community storm shelters is a cost-effective approach compared to individual installations. The shared financial burden makes it more feasible for local municipalities and encourages widespread adoption.

Community Bonding

Storm shelters can also serve as community centers during non-emergency times, promoting social interaction and community bonding. This dual-purpose functionality strengthens the fabric of the neighborhood.

Government Initiatives and Community Partnerships

Recognizing the importance of community storm shelters, various Texas municipalities have initiated programs to build and maintain these structures. Government incentives, coupled with community partnerships and active participation, are crucial in ensuring the widespread adoption and success of such initiatives.
